Scott Lau, 50, of South Bend, Indiana passed away August 7, 2026 at Memorial Hospital.

He was born to Susan Krawczyk (VanLue) and Paul Lau I on January 2, 1976. He graduated from Lasalle High School. While he held a variety of jobs throughout his life, his passion as a truck driver always remained. Scott could always be seen wearing his favorite Packers hat and, even through their continuous losses, remained an avid Packers fan.

Scott leaves behind his wife, Heather Lau (MacLeod), his children: Krystina Lau (Nicholas), Alexis Lau, Ashleigh MacLeod, Katie Selis, Haylee Selis, William Selis, Paige Lau, and Mason Lau; his mother, Susan Krawczyk, brother, Paul Lau Jr. sister, Julie Meisner, stepsister, Heather Pollard (John), stepbrother, Richard Krawczyk Jr. and multiple nieces, nephews, cousins, and grandchildren. He is preceded in death by his father, Paul Lau Sr, his stepfather, Richard Krawczyk Sr, his stepsister, Aaron Krawczyk, and his daughter, Jennifer Lau.

Despite the struggles he faced in his adult life, Scott’s final wish was to become an organ donor. This selfless decision speaks volumes about the kind of person he was, showing that even in his final wishes, he wanted to help others and give someone else the opportunity at a second chance. His willingness to give of himself after death reflects his deep sense of generosity and is a lasting testament to his character.

A celebration of life will be held at a later date. In lieu of flowers, the family wishes that any donations be made to the Indiana Donor Network, as Scott would have wanted.
